Hey there! As a gutter cleaning expert, I can tell you that cleaning gutters with a power washer can be an effective way to get rid of stubborn debris. Here are some steps you can take:

  1. Start by gathering your supplies: You’ll need a ladder, a power washer, a gutter scoop or trowel, work gloves, and safety goggles.
  2. Position your ladder: Make sure your ladder is positioned at a comfortable angle against your house and is stable.
  3. Use a gutter scoop or trowel to remove any large debris that has accumulated in your gutters.
  4. Put on your safety goggles and use the power washer to spray out your gutters, working from one end to the other. Start with a low pressure setting and increase the pressure as needed to dislodge stubborn debris.
  5. Once you’ve finished spraying out your gutters, use a garden hose to flush out any remaining debris and ensure water is flowing properly.
  6. Clean up any debris that may have fallen on the ground below.

It’s important to exercise caution when using a power washer and to wear safety gear to protect yourself from flying debris.
